Sheryl Anson left this review about New Fullbrook
The Bar area seems popular with many local clientelle and is situated on a busy main road. This pub has an Indian restaurant area attached called Desi. This is where this establishment fails badly. The service was appaling. No plates, cutlery or serviettes to eat the cold poppadums. Unappetising looking food swimming in oil left on the table by a 'waiter'? wearing a puffa coat. Still no plates or cutlery after five minutes waiting. We voted with our feet only to be threatened and verbally abused by the chef who demanded payment for something we hadn't and couldn't eat. He took a mobile phone from the table and refused to return it until the meal was paid for. He eventually gave it back but not before more verbal abuse. Its a good job no large parties arrived to eat Your chef would never have coped. We were the only customers in there on a Friday night, that speaks for itself. Sorry New Fullbrook, get rid of the restaurant,Epic fail.

Soup Dragon left this review about New Fullbrook
A large detached brick corner pub. The interior is vast. It has three rooms; a dining room all painted white it seems and a bar that has Sky TV, which is a bit bland and scruffy – but is in the process of being done out by the new owners. The third room seems to be a function room. The service was nice enough and the clientele a little ‘older’, but friendly enough. I seem to remember popping in here once several years back, prior to a Walsall match. The beer was simply the usual stuff on keg, with Highgate MILD, which was ok. Just a nothing kind of place at the moment and a little out of the way for me, so I wouldn’t bother going back. Needs a bit of time to see how it goes – good luck to them
